Microsoft Surface Phone
More rumour. A report by the Wall Street Journal says Microsoft has been talking to makers of phone components to spec out its own smartphone design. (The one at left is a concept design by Jonas Daehnert.) Maybe it’s just testing the waters, but if Microsoft does make its own phone, it would fit with its move into hardware a la Surface tablets. Sort of like Apple a la iPhones and iPads.
